GENERAL COMMENTS: Produced with Sangiovese grapes grown on the Montornello exposure; if the summer is cool and rainy this wine's structure is diluted and it develops a more ample complexity.
PRODUCTION ZONE: Bibbiano, Castellina in Chianti
CRU: Montornello Vineyards
VINEYARD SURFACE AREA: 15 hectares
SOIL TYPE: Pliocene calcareous-clay sediments, with stratified limestone rock in the form of river pebbles, dissolved with blades of sand, chalk and red clay
EXPOSURE: North-East
HARVEST PERIOD: From October 10
GRAPE YIELD PER HECTARE: 45 quintals
COMPOSITION: 100% Sangiovese grapes
FERMENTATION: 33 days in concrete vats, délestage
AGEING: 36 months, partly in concrete and partly in French oak barrels; additional 6 months of ageing in bottles
NUMBER OF BOTTLES: 30,000
ALCOHOL CONTENT: 15%
GROWING SEASON: Cold, snowy winter; cool and moist spring and summer; hot and windy autumn.
COLOR: Intense ruby red, garnet hues
AROMAS: Cherry, sour black cherry, ripe red fruits with hints of underbrush and spice
NOSE: Dense structure accompanied by lively freshness and persistent flavor
